Elias is the son of Elisa S. Presley (~1793-~1857) who was born in Anson County, North Carolina and passed away in Butler County, Alabama and Mary Margaret Moore (~1802-~1879) who was born in South Carolina and passed away in Butler County, Alabama.

~ ~ ~

On the 4th of January 1861 in Muscogee County, Georgia, Elias married Rebecca Josephine Stinson (1846-1922), daughter of Elias D. Stinson (~1819-~1865) who was born in Pike County, Alabama and passed away in Elmira Military Prison, Elmira, Chemung County, New York and Mary Margaret Moore (~1820-~1857) who was born in Darlington County, South Carolina and passed away in Butler County, North Carolina.

PRESLEY, E. B.,
(Private, Company “A” 1st Battalion Alabama Artillery) Died February 28, 1865 at Elmira Military Prison, Elmira New York. Buried in Plot Number 2131 at Woodlawn National Cemetery.
